Summary of the evidence supporting Saccharomyces boulardii CNCM I-745 as a unique yeast probiotic with distinct advantages over bacterial probiotics in specific clinical scenarios. Intrinsic antibiotic resistance allows concurrent use with antimicrobial therapy.
